Reduces motion blur in video and fast
moving games. Sets the OverDrive
feature on or off; the default setting is
Off. (select models)
Displays the status of the Dynamic
Contrast Ratio (DCR) setting. DCR
automatically adjusts the balance
between white and black levels to
provide you with an optimal image.
Select:
On
Off
The factory default is On or Off,
depending on the model.
Adjusts the position of the OSD menu
on the screen.
Changes the viewing position of the
OSD menu to the left or right area of the
screen. The factory default range is 50.
Changes the viewing position of the
OSD menu to the top or bottom area of
the screen. The factory default range is
50.
Adjust to view the background
information through the OSD.
Sets the time in seconds that the OSD is
visible after the last button is pressed.
The factory default is 30 seconds.
Selects the Landscape or Portrait
position. The factory default is
Landscape. (select models)
Selects the power-management features
of the monitor.
Enables the power saving feature (see
"Power-Saver Feature" in this chapter).
Select:
On
Off
The factory default is On.
Restores power to the monitor following
an unexpected removal of power.
Select:
On
Off
The factory default is On.
